  • 2-1. US-China AI infrastructure battle

  • The competition between the United States and China in the realm of artificial intelligence has transcended mere technological advancement; it is fundamentally about control over the underlying infrastructure that supports AI capabilities. Recent insights indicate that AI compute infrastructure is increasingly viewed as a geostrategic asset akin to oil or semiconductors. The distinction between various nations has become stark, creating a new landscape where countries are categorized based on their levels of access to AI compute resources. Current research highlights a division into three primarily defined zones: 'Compute North', 'Compute South', and 'Compute Desert'. 'Compute North' includes nations with advanced training capabilities, primarily in the Global North, which possess the necessary infrastructure, such as data centers, that allows for the effective development and execution of advanced AI models. The United States leads this category with extensive hyperscale cloud regions and technological prowess. In contrast, 'Compute South' encompasses countries that may leverage some level of AI technologies but cannot train frontier models due to outdated infrastructure. Lastly, the so-called 'Compute Deserts' represent nations lacking any meaningful AI compute infrastructure, making them completely dependent on external AI technologies, thus undermining their sovereignty and influence in the digital age. This evolving competition is indicative of a broader struggle for national security and economic dominance, particularly as advances in AI offer potential leverage in both civilian and military applications. The stakes are high, and nations increasingly view their ability to shape and secure AI infrastructure as integral to their future standing on the global stage.

  • 4-2. Nvidia and Microsoft driving market rally

  • The stock market is currently witnessing a significant rally, primarily driven by the unprecedented performance of technology giants, particularly Nvidia and Microsoft. These companies have significantly benefited from their leadership in AI technologies and cloud services, resulting in impressive stock valuations. Nvidia, known for its dominant role in AI accelerators and GPUs, achieved a remarkable milestone on July 9, 2025, by becoming the world's first company to reach a $4 trillion market capitalization. This surge has fueled confidence across markets, contributing to a broader bullish sentiment among investors. Microsoft has also joined this elite club, achieving a $4 trillion valuation on July 31, 2025, driven by substantial gains in its Azure platform and the integration of AI in its product offerings, particularly the widely adopted AI assistant Copilot.

  • 4-3. Wall Street outlook on AMD vs. Palantir

  • Market analysts are increasingly paying attention to the competitive landscape regarding AI-related stocks, specifically focusing on Advanced Micro Devices (AMD) and Palantir Technologies (PLTR). As of September 6, 2025, AMD has seen approximately a 35% increase in stock value during the year, underpinned by robust interest in its AI GPUs and strategic partnerships with companies like IBM for advancing quantum computing. In contrast, Palantir has experienced a staggering 107% surge in its stock price, reflecting strong demand for its AI-driven data analytics platforms across both government and commercial sectors. Analysts view AMD as a stock with significant upside potential due to its evolving market position in AI technologies, while Palantir's strong revenue growth indicates its continued success in the burgeoning AI sector.

  • 4-5. Investor pick: Nvidia vs. Intel

  • In the ongoing narrative of AI investment, Nvidia continues to dominate the conversation due to its substantial market share in the AI chip sector, controlling about 90%. Conversely, Intel's position has been challenged as it seeks to regain footing amidst Nvidia's ascendance. While Nvidia's stock has soared over 1,000% since the rise of ChatGPT, concerns regarding its customer concentration and future growth potential had led some analysts, like the investor known as Value Portfolio, to advise caution. Meanwhile, Intel is undergoing a significant transformation under new CEO Lip-Bu Tan, with a renewed focus on AI capabilities that could position it to capitalize on opportunities in the evolving tech landscape. As of September 6, 2025, both companies represent contrasting investment cases in the burgeoning AI market, with Nvidia seen as a leader and Intel attempting a comeback.

  • 5-5. Global AI market size and growth projections

  • The global market for artificial intelligence is experiencing unprecedented growth, with current projections estimating the market will escalate from $371.71 billion in 2025 to an astonishing $2,407.02 billion by 2032, driven by a compound annual growth rate (CAGR) of 30.6%. This rapid expansion is fueled by the integration of AI into enterprise solutions, infrastructure modernization, and autonomous decision-making systems.

  • Factors such as the democratization of AI, enabled through cloud-native platforms, are facilitating easier access for enterprises of all sizes to adopt AI technologies. With hyperscalers like Microsoft and Google providing easy-to-integrate solutions, the barriers to implementing AI are diminishing, allowing businesses of all sizes to engage in experimentation. This inclusive growth potentially empowers even small enterprises to innovate, thus reshaping competitive dynamics across various sectors.
